Factors that Influence Earnings

  1. Follower Count: The number of followers an influencer has remains a crucial factor in determining their earning potential. Brands often look for influencers with a large following as it allows them to reach a wider audience. However, it’s important to note that follower count alone is not the sole indicator of success. Engagement rate plays a significant role as well.
  2. Engagement Rate: Brands are increasingly focusing on engagement rate as a measure of an influencer’s effectiveness. High engagement indicates that followers are actively interacting with the influencer’s content, which can lead to better results for brands. Influencers with a highly engaged audience are often seen as more valuable partners for collaborations.
  3. Niche Expertise: Influencers who have established themselves as experts in a specific niche often have higher earning potential. Their specialized knowledge and credibility within their niche make them attractive to brands targeting a particular audience. Niche influencers can command higher rates and secure partnerships that align with their area of expertise.
  4. Brand Collaborations: Collaborating with brands is a significant revenue stream for influencers. Brands may approach influencers for sponsored posts, product endorsements, or ambassadorships. These collaborations can be mutually beneficial, allowing influencers to monetize their content while providing brands with authentic and targeted promotion.
  5. Monetizing Content: Influencers have various avenues to monetize their content beyond brand collaborations. They can create and sell their merchandise, offer exclusive content or services through subscriptions, participate in affiliate marketing programs, or even host sponsored events. Diversifying revenue streams can contribute to an influencer’s overall earnings.
  6. Market Demand and Rates: The influencer market is dynamic, and rates can vary based on factors such as industry trends, geographic location, and the influencer’s reputation. Influencers who consistently deliver high-quality content and demonstrate a strong return on investment for brands often have the leverage to negotiate higher rates.
  7. Long-Term Partnerships: Building long-term partnerships with brands can provide influencers with stable income and opportunities for growth. These partnerships often involve ongoing collaborations, brand ambassadorships, or even equity partnerships. Establishing trust and delivering consistent results can lead to lucrative long-term relationships.
  8. Business Savviness: Influencers who understand the business side of their industry tend to have an advantage. They can negotiate contracts, manage their finances effectively, and strategically position themselves in the market. Being business-savvy allows influencers to maximize their earnings and make informed decisions about their career.

Industry Trends and Predictions
Emerging Trends in Influencer Marketing: Influencer marketing is constantly evolving, and there are several emerging trends that can impact influencer earnings. One trend is the rise of micro-influencers, who have smaller but highly engaged audiences. Brands are recognizing the value of these influencers, leading to increased partnerships and potential earnings. Another trend is the growth of video content, with platforms like TikTok and YouTube gaining popularity. Influencers who can create compelling video content have the potential to attract more brand collaborations and increase their earnings.

The Future of Influencer Earnings: The influencer industry is expected to continue growing, and with it, influencer earnings are likely to increase. As brands allocate larger portions of their marketing budgets to influencer partnerships, influencers have the opportunity to negotiate higher rates. Additionally, as influencer marketing becomes more regulated and transparent, brands may be willing to invest more in influencers who can demonstrate authentic engagement and measurable results. This could lead to increased earnings for influencers who can provide value to brands.
